Description
Welcome to 2228 Carpenter Street, masterfully crafted in 2017, a 3-bedroom, 3-bathroom residence in the heart of Graduate Hospital. This stunning townhome blends timeless architectural character with sophisticated, modern design—featuring an exposed brick wall with raw wood beam accents, and a dramatic custom floating oak staircase that sets the tone for bespoke urban living. Thoughtfully designed across multiple levels, this home features three distinct outdoor spaces, including a private rear patio, primary bedroom balcony, and an expansive rooftop deck with sweeping 360-degree views of the Philadelphia skyline—ideal for both relaxing in solitude and entertaining in style. The open-concept main level is bathed in natural light from oversized windows and showcases a harmonious mix of modern finishes and historic texture. Flowing seamlessly into a warm, inviting dining and living space anchored by the showstopper floating staircase, this is the definition of modern open concept living. The chef’s kitchen is a dream, complete with stainless steel appliances, a breakfast bar with seating, granite countertops, and custom cabinetry. On the second floor, you’ll find two spacious bedrooms, each with generous closet space and easy access to a full bathroom and full-sized stacked laundry, perfect for guests, family, or a home office setup. The third-floor primary suite is a private sanctuary, featuring an en suite spa-inspired bath, walk-in closet, and its own balcony retreat—all drenched in natural light. Luxurious finishes, from imported tile to a dual vanity, create an indulgent escape in the heart of the city. The fully finished basement offers flexible bonus living space—ideal as a play space, home gym, or guest quarters—with a third full bathroom and additional storage to suit your lifestyle. This home is located on a quiet, tree-lined block in the Graduate Hospital neighborhood—just steps from Julian Abele Park, the Schuylkill River Trail, CHOP, Penn, and vibrant neighborhood spots like Sidecar Bar, Loco Pez, Dock Street Brewery, Giant Heirloom Market plus the brand new Aldi, CVS and more on Washington Ave. Combining character, craftsmanship, and contemporary elegance, 2228 Carpenter Street is a rare opportunity to own a true Philadelphia gem with every luxury convenience.
